Air Viscosity: Dynamic and Kinematic Viscosity

Calculate air dynamic or kinematic viscosity at given temperatures and atmospheric pressure. Temperature must be within -100 to 1600 °C, -150 to 2900 °F, 175 to 1900 K, or 310 to 3400 °R for valid values. Outputs are provided in multiple units including Pa·s, cP, mPa·s, lb·f·s/ft², cSt, m²/s, and ft²/s.
